low volatility slots have become a defining feature of modern slot gaming, offering players a dynamic alternative to traditional spinning reels. At the heart of this innovation lies the low volatility slot games, which determines how clusters of symbols form winning combinations and trigger cascading effects. Unlike classic payline slots, where wins depend on symbols aligning on predetermined lines, flock pays mechanics allow wins to form when a specified number of matching symbols seem contiguous to one another, either horizontally or vertically. This system of rules often spans a grid of varying sizes, such as 6×6 or 7×7, where symbols knock off into place rather than spin. When a winning cluster is formed, those symbols are removed, and brand-new ones cascade down from above, creating opportunities for consecutive wins from a single spin. This cascading feature, sometimes called avalanche or tumbling reels, can chain multiple wins in rapid succession, with each cascade potentially increasing multipliers or unlocking special features. The grid layout often includes special symbols ilk wilds, which can substitute for any standard symbolization to help form clusters, and scatter symbols that initiation bonus rounds or free spins. In many games, the cluster size required for a win varies, with larger clusters yielding higher payouts. For instance, a cluster of 5 matching symbols might pay a small amount, while a cluster of 15 or more could award a substantive jackpot. The mechanics also ofttimes integrated increasing multipliers that grow with each sequent cascade, adding a layer of excitation as players trust for a long chain of wins. Additionally, some games introduce expanding symbols that cover entire rows or columns when they form part of a cluster, enhancing the potentiality for massive payouts. The visual feedback of clusters exploding and new symbols falling keeps the gameplay engaging and fast-paced. "expanded_text": "### Megaways: A Revolution in Reel Mechanics\nMegaways slots have fundamentally altered the landscape of internet slots by introducing a dynamic reel system of rules where the number of symbols on apiece reel changes with every spin. Developed by Big Time Gaming, this mechanic can provide up to 117,649 ways to win, though some titles the like Bonanza or Extra Chilli have pushed beyond that, with Bonanza featuring 6 reels that can display between 2 and 7 symbols each, resulting in up to 117,649 ways, while Extra Chilli uses a similar setup but with a maximum of 7 symbols per reel, also hitting the 117,649 cap. The nucleus invoke lies in the unpredictability; each spin feels unique as the reel heights shift, creating a fresh grid and new winning opportunities. For instance, one spin might demo only 2 symbols on the first reel and 7 on the lastly, while the next could have 5 on to each one, drastically altering the list of active paylines. The cascading reels feature, often paired with Megaways, removes winning symbols and allows new ones to fall into place, potentially triggering consecutive wins from a single spin. This combination of variable ways and cascading wins keeps players engaged, as the potential for a monolithic winnings builds with each successive cascade. Many Megaways games also include a multiplier that increases with every cascade, often capping at a high value like x10 or x20, as seen in games the like White Rabbit where the multiplier can reaching up to x20 during the bonus round. This multiplier, when applied to a replete control grid of matching symbols, can resultant in astronomical wins, making Megaways a staple in high-volatility gameplay. The visual plan often incorporates themes like adventure, fantasy, or classic fruit machines, but the core mechanic remains the asterisk, ensuring that even after years, Megaways slots continue to pull both new and veteran players seeking the thrill of unpredictable, high-reward gameplay.\n\n### Hold & Win: The Player-Controlled Bonus\nHold & Win is a mechanic that has turn synonymous with high-paced, interactive bonus rounds. In this feature, players are typically presented with a control grid of symbols, often including coin values and special symbols like ‘Hold & Win’ icons. The round begins with a set number of spins, usually three, and from each one time a special symbol lands, it locks in place and resets the spin counter. The goal is to fill the entire grid with these symbols, which often triggers the maximum jackpot. The thrill comes from the tautness as the spin counter ticks down; every latest symbol adds hope, while a white spin reduces it. What are Megaways slots and how do they work?

Megaways slots use a random reel modifier to change the list of symbols appearing on each reel with every spin, offering up to 117,649 or more ways to win.

How does the Hold & Win feature operate?

Hold & Win triggers when special symbols land, locking them in station and awarding respins; each fresh symbol resets the respin counter, often leading to jackpot prizes.

What defines a Cluster Pays slot?

Cluster Pays slots pay out when groups of matching symbols unite vertically or horizontally, sort of than using traditional paylines, and often include cascading reels.

Is buying a bonus feature worth the cost?

Bonus Buy lets you pay a fixed amount to directly access a slot’s free spins or bonus labialize, but it typically costs 100x to 500x your stake and removes the chance of triggering it naturally.

What are expanding reels and cascading symbols?

Expanding reels increase the figure of rows during gameplay, often after wins, while cascading symbols remove winning combinations to allow new symbols to devolve in, creating consecutive win opportunities.
